What Is a βTrue AI Laptopβ in 2026?
Many brands today market laptops as AI PCs because they include an NPU (Neural Processing Unit). While NPUs are useful for basic background tasks, they are massively overhyped for real AI workloads.
The Truth:
- NPUs handle lightweight AI tasks (noise cancellation, webcam effects)
- They cannot handle:
- AI image generation
- AI video processing
- LLMs (Large Language Models)
- Engineering simulations
- CUDA-accelerated workloads
A true AI laptop must include a dedicated GPU (dGPU)βand in 2026, that means NVIDIA RTX 50 Series laptops.

Why CPUs Alone Canβt Handle Modern AI Tasks
A common mistake among students is assuming that a powerful CPU is enough.
Reality Check:
- CPUs process tasks sequentially
- AI workloads require parallel computation
- GPUs can process thousands of operations simultaneously
This is why:
- AI image generation
- Video AI effects
- LLMs
- 3D simulations
β¦run 10β50x faster on GPUs compared to CPUs.

Ideal AI Laptop Specifications for Engineering Students (2026)
When choosing an AI laptop, aim for these minimum specs:
- GPU: RTX 5060 / 5070 or higher
- RAM: 16GB minimum (32GB recommended)
- CPU: Ryzen 7 / Ryzen 9 or Intel Ultra 7 / Ultra 9
- Storage: 1TB NVMe SSD
- Cooling: High-performance thermal design
- Display: 100% sRGB or DCI-P3 for creators
